== English == === Etymology === From fore- +‎ skin, a loose calque of Latin praepūtium. Compare German Vorhaut, etc. First attested in c. 1535. === Pronunciation === (Received Pronunciation) IPA(key): /ˈfɔːskɪn/ (General American) IPA(key): /ˈfɔɹskɪn/ (rhotic, without the horse–hoarse merger) IPA(key): /ˈfo(ː)ɹskɪn/ (non-rhotic, without the horse–hoarse merger) IPA(key): /ˈfoəskɪn/ Hyphenation: fore‧skin === Noun === foreskin (plural foreskins) (anatomy) The nerve-dense, retractable fold of skin which covers and protects the glans of the penis in humans and some other mammals. Synonym: penile foreskin (anatomy) Ellipsis of clitoral foreskin. Synonym: clitoral hood ==== Synonyms ==== prepuce See also Thesaurus:foreskin ==== Derived terms ==== ==== Translations ==== === Verb === foreskin (third-person singular simple present foreskins, present participle foreskinning, simple past and past participle foreskinned) (transitive, intransitive) To remove the foreskin.
